@RunWith(MockitoJUnitRunner.class)
public class BasicRedisPersistentEntityUnitTests<T, ID extends Serializable> {
public @Rule ExpectedException expectedException = ExpectedException.none();
@Mock TypeInformation<T> entityInformation;
@Mock KeySpaceResolver keySpaceResolver;
@Mock TimeToLiveAccessor ttlAccessor;
BasicRedisPersistentEntity<T> entity;
@Before
@SuppressWarnings("unchecked")
public void setUp() {
when(entityInformation.getType()).thenReturn((Class<T>) ConversionTestEntities.Person.class);
entity = new BasicRedisPersistentEntity<T>(entityInformation, keySpaceResolver, ttlAccessor);
}
@Test // DATAREDIS-425
public void addingMultipleIdPropertiesWithoutAnExplicitOneThrowsException() {
expectedException.expect(MappingException.class);
expectedException.expectMessage("Attempt to add id property");
expectedException.expectMessage("but already have an property");
RedisPersistentProperty property1 = mock(RedisPersistentProperty.class);
when(property1.isIdProperty()).thenReturn(true);
RedisPersistentProperty property2 = mock(RedisPersistentProperty.class);
when(property2.isIdProperty()).thenReturn(true);
entity.addPersistentProperty(property1);
entity.addPersistentProperty(property2);
}
@Test // DATAREDIS-425
@SuppressWarnings("unchecked")
public void addingMultipleExplicitIdPropertiesThrowsException() {
expectedException.expect(MappingException.class);
expectedException.expectMessage("Attempt to add explicit id property");
expectedException.expectMessage("but already have an property");
RedisPersistentProperty property1 = mock(RedisPersistentProperty.class);
when(property1.isIdProperty()).thenReturn(true);
when(property1.isAnnotationPresent(any(Class.class))).thenReturn(true);
RedisPersistentProperty property2 = mock(RedisPersistentProperty.class);
when(property2.isIdProperty()).thenReturn(true);
when(property2.isAnnotationPresent(any(Class.class))).thenReturn(true);
entity.addPersistentProperty(property1);
entity.addPersistentProperty(property2);
}
@Test // DATAREDIS-425
@SuppressWarnings("unchecked")
public void explicitIdPropertiyShouldBeFavoredOverNonExplicit() {
RedisPersistentProperty property1 = mock(RedisPersistentProperty.class);
when(property1.isIdProperty()).thenReturn(true);
RedisPersistentProperty property2 = mock(RedisPersistentProperty.class);
when(property2.isIdProperty()).thenReturn(true);
when(property2.isAnnotationPresent(any(Class.class))).thenReturn(true);
entity.addPersistentProperty(property1);
entity.addPersistentProperty(property2);
assertThat(entity.getIdProperty(), is(equalTo(Optional.of(property2))));
}
}
